class TemplateNotFoundError
テンプレート ID は RMS サービスでは認識されません。
まとめ
メンバー | 説明 |
---|---|
public std::string mMessage | まだ文書化されていません。 |
public std::map<std::string, std::string> mDebugInfo | まだ文書化されていません。 |
public std::string mName | まだ文書化されていません。 |
public ErrorType mType | まだ文書化されていません。 |
public ErrorCode GetErrorCode() const | 無効な入力の errorCode を取得します。 |
public char const* what() const | エラー メッセージを取得します。 |
public std::shared_ptr<Error> Clone() const | エラーを複製します。 |
public virtual ErrorType GetErrorType() const | エラーの種類を取得します。 |
public const std::string& GetErrorName() const | エラー名を取得します。 |
public const std::string& GetMessage() const | エラー メッセージを取得します。 |
public void SetMessage(const std::string& msg) | エラー メッセージを設定します。 |
public void AddDebugInfo(const std::string& key, const std::string& value) | デバッグ情報エントリを追加します。 |
public const std::map<std::string, std::string>& GetDebugInfo() const | デバッグ情報を取得します。 |
enum ErrorCode | 無効な入力エラーの ErrorCode。 |
メンバー
mMessage
まだ文書化されていません。
mDebugInfo
まだ文書化されていません。
mName
まだ文書化されていません。
ErrorType
まだ文書化されていません。
GetErrorCode 関数
無効な入力の errorCode を取得します。
戻り値: 無効な入力エラーの ErrorCode
what 関数
エラー メッセージを取得します。
戻り値: エラー メッセージ
Clone 関数
エラーを複製します。
戻り値: エラーの複製。
GetErrorType 関数
エラーの種類を取得します。
戻り値: エラーの種類。
GetErrorName 関数
エラー名を取得します。
戻り値: エラー名。
GetMessage 関数
エラー メッセージを取得します。
戻り値: エラー メッセージ。
SetMessage 関数
エラー メッセージを設定します。
パラメーター:
- msg: エラー メッセージ。
AddDebugInfo 関数
デバッグ情報エントリを追加します。
パラメーター:
key: デバッグ情報キー
value: デバッグ情報の値
GetDebugInfo 関数
デバッグ情報を取得します。
戻り値: デバッグ情報 (キー、値)
ErrorCode 列挙型
値 | 説明 |
---|---|
全般 | 一般的な無効な入力エラー |
FileIsTooLargeForProtection | ファイルが大きすぎて保護できません |
ParameterParsing | パラメーターを正しく解析できません |
LicenseNotTrusted | 発行ライセンスが信頼できるソースによって発行されていません |
DoubleKey | 二重キー暗号化のパラメーターが必要であり、存在していません |
FileFormatNotSupported | 入力ファイルの形式はサポートされていません |
無効な入力エラーの ErrorCode。